Crown molding installation services involve attaching decorative trim along the upper edges where walls meet ceilings, enhancing the overall aesthetic of a room. The process typically includes measuring and cutting the molding to fit specific spaces, followed by securing it in place with nails or adhesive. Skilled contractors ensure precise alignment and seamless finishing, which may involve filling gaps and painting or staining the molding to match the interior decor. Material and Design Costs - The cost of crown molding installation typically ranges from $6 to $20 per linear foot, depending on the material and complexity of the design. For example, simple MDF moldings may cost around $6-$10 per foot, while intricate wood designs can reach $20 or more per foot.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ing crown molding generally fall between $4 and $10 per linear foot. The total labor price may vary based on the project's scope and the local contractor's rates in Ellenton, FL.
Total Project Cost - Overall, the complete installation of crown molding can range from $300 to $1,500 for an average room, depending on the length of the walls and the chosen materials. Larger or more complex projects tend to be at the higher end of this range.
Additional Factors - Costs may increase if additional work such as wall preparation or painting is required, which can add $1 to $3 per linear foot.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ific project details and preferences.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is crown molding installation? Crown molding installation involves attaching decorative trim to the junction of walls and ceilings to enhance interior aesthetics.
How long does crown molding installation typ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but local pros can provide estimates based on specific requirements.
What types of crown molding materials are available? Common materials include wood, plaster, polyurethane, and polystyrene, each offering different styles and finishes.
Is crown molding installation suitable for all ceiling heights? Most ceiling heights can accommodate crown molding, though taller ceilings may require different molding styles or sizes.
